Highlights
Are people in Dunbar older or younger than people in Winston-Salem?
- The Median Age in Dunbar is 10.9 years older than in Winston-Salem.

Are housing costs cheaper in Dunbar or Winston-Salem?
- Dunbar housing costs are 51.7% less expensive than Winston-Salem hous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Dunbar or Winston-Salem?
- The average commute for residents of Dunbar is 1.5 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Winston-Salem.
